Output 2522590107e1d181cf2f82658603b69b07c20b1fb0e221b77a5e6e1a3e121706:0

value
34689
script pubkey
OP_0 OP_PUSHBYTES_20 3865bfaf4feabdae1e0b41a2ff3bdab2e3454fc8
address
bc1q8pjmlt60a276u8stgx307w76kt352n7gp6py0v
transaction
2522590107e1d181cf2f82658603b69b07c20b1fb0e221b77a5e6e1a3e121706
spent
true